Data Retention

‍ Medical records are usually kept for:

‍ ‍

  • Adults: at least 8 years after last treatment

  • Children: until age 25

‍ ‍These retention standards follow guidance from the National Health Service.

Your Rights

‍ Under the UK General Data Protection Regulation, patients have the right to:

‍ ‍

  • Access their personal data

  • Request corrections

  • Request deletion in certain circumstances

  • Restrict processing of their data

  • File a complaint with the Information Commissioner’s Office.
